Setting Up Your GoPro 7 Silver as a Webcam

Now that you have all the necessary equipment, let’s walk through the setup process:

Step 1: Install the GoPro Webcam Software

Visit the GoPro website and download the GoPro Webcam Software for your operating system (Windows or macOS). Follow the installation instructions to install the software on your computer.

Step 2: Connect Your GoPro 7 Silver to Your Computer

Connect your GoPro 7 Silver to your computer using a USB-C cable. Make sure the camera is turned off before connecting it to your computer.

Step 3: Launch the GoPro Webcam Software

Launch the GoPro Webcam Software on your computer. You should see a prompt asking you to connect your GoPro camera. Click “Connect” to establish a connection between the camera and the software.

Step 4: Select the GoPro 7 Silver as Your Webcam

Once connected, the software will recognize your GoPro 7 Silver as a webcam. You may need to select the camera as your preferred webcam device in your computer’s settings or within the software.

Step 5: Adjust Camera Settings

Within the GoPro Webcam Software, you can adjust various camera settings, such as:

  • Resolution: Choose from a range of resolutions, including 1080p, 720p, and more.
  • Frame Rate: Select from various frame rates, including 60fps, 30fps, and more.
  • Field of View: Adjust the field of view to suit your needs, from narrow to wide-angle.
  • Audio: Select the audio input source, such as the built-in microphone or an external microphone.

Tips and Tricks for Optimal Performance

To get the most out of your GoPro 7 Silver webcam, follow these tips and tricks:

  • Use a Tripod or Mount: Stabilize your camera to reduce shaky footage and ensure a smooth, professional-looking video feed.
  • Position the Camera Correctly: Experiment with different camera angles and positions to find the most flattering and engaging perspective.
  • Invest in an External Microphone: If you’re in a noisy environment or want to ensure crystal-clear audio, consider investing in an external microphone.
  • Monitor Your Lighting: Ensure you’re well-lit, with soft, diffused light that minimizes harsh shadows and glare.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If you encounter any issues while using your GoPro 7 Silver as a webcam, try the following troubleshooting steps:

  • Check Your Connection: Ensure your camera is properly connected to your computer and the software is recognizing it.
  • Restart the Software: Sometimes, simply restarting the GoPro Webcam Software can resolve connectivity issues.
  • Update Your Software: Make sure you’re running the latest version of the GoPro Webcam Software to ensure compatibility and bug fixes.
